CHAPTER III - SHE'S GOT A TICKET TO RIDE
They would be due back in eight days. The trip to
Paris was to last six days, five nights; and on the return
leg they had an option of going to some up-scale health spa
in North Carolina or staying in New York and find'
themselves at some seminar - retreat kind of thing. A rather
open, loose itinerary to say the least. I'd be supportive
as I could. There'd be an option to add extra days, of
course.
The one positive I'd find usually buoyant in Desire
would be her feeling on alcohol and drugs; she was a devout
homeopath, using many herbal extracts on a daily basis. But
many times she'd appear high to people who wouldn't actually
know her well.
When I felt somewhat uneasy with her would be in her
risk taking when she really didn't have to in the least;
yes, here I had a hard time with her judgment: to the edge
of the envelope she'd often plunge. It'd be the way she
was - what drove her husband away. So, here, Janine became
her guardian angel: to pull this off, one cannot let the
person whom you're protecting know.
So begins our education of others. And ourselves.
Each would be inordinately invested in the other. As
they found their seats on the 747, Janine would be subdued,
while Desire sensed some grand design of things, inhaling
the smells and sights of Paris, maybe gleaned from forgotten
images of some paintings of Renoir and Toulose-Lautrec.
Janine made some guilt-ridden remark about not
upgrading to first class or something like that.
Desire leapt nearly out of her seat. "...No, really,
Second class's just fine. Let's not be so American."
"I miss my guys some. Already. Shane thinks I'm way
over-packed. I hope-"
"Hey you can buy," Desire laughed, "Whatever, you know?"
"I've got four packs of Juicy Fruit. Lots of extra
Kleenex - they use that grocery bag stuff-two Clancy books
and a bank draft of one-hundred-eighty-six thousand."
Desire pulled up her carry on bag. "I've got a dozen
'Suzy Q's', a guide to the underground haunts of Paris."
She then reached out a troop-size pack of condoms. "And my
Safety kit. For you, too."
"Des, I thought you were trying to-"
"It's cool: only the most dire emergencies. And this
stuff, strawberry flavor - I think they prefer natural
flavor - and a partially opened panty liner."
Their plane flew off into the setting night, each bound
for the same destination, yet with far different designs on
what to do, just how to spend their time.
